This is useful if you use FBX that loses hierarchy information and you want to preserve between Blender / 3ds max projects. You can also use this addon to save current Blender / 3ds max hierarchy, play around with it and take it back. It also has option to export 3ds max model hierarchy and import it as collections hierarchy in Blender. The problem you might met is when you export model from Blender to 3ds Max using fbx you lose all the collections hierarchy when you probably expect to preserve this hierarchy as layers.
